Bitset count time complexity
WebApr 12,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ebJan 27, 2024 · The class template bitset represents a fixed-size sequence of N bits. Bitsets can be manipulated by standard logic operators and converted to and from strings and …
Bitset count time complexity
Did you know?
WebAug 3, 2024 · Count all possible Paths between two Vertices; Find all distinct subsets of a given set using BitMasking Approach; Find if there is a path of more than k length from a source; Print all paths from a given source to a destination; Print all possible strings that can be made by placing spaces Webbitset count public member function std:: bitset ::count C++98 C++11 size_t count () const; Count bits set Returns the number of bits in the bitset that are set (i.e., …
WebSep 30,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ebMar 12, 2024 · 2 Answers. This solution will cause a time limit exceeded. bitset::count () is O (n) in worst case. The total complexity of your code is O (n^3). In the worst-case the number of operations would be 3000^3 > 10^10 which is too large. I'm not sure this solution is the best you can come up with, but it is based on the original solution, with a ...
WebA bitset stores bits (elements with only two possible values: 0 or 1, true or false, ...). The class emulates an array of bool elements, but optimized for space allocation: generally, … WebDec 31, 2024 · Sieve of Eratosthenes is an algorithm for finding all the prime numbers in a segment [ 1; n] using O ( n log log n) operations. The algorithm is very simple: at the …
WebThe operations on bitset has a complexity of O (N / K), where N is the length of the bitset and K is the register size of the system (generally 32 or 64). Bitset also has other …
WebJan 4, 2024 · Approach: The idea is to use a greedy approach to solve this problem. Below are the steps: Initialize a bitset, say bit[], of size 10 5 + 5 and set bit[0] = 1.; Traverse through the array and for each array element arr[i], update bit as bit = bit << arr[i] to have bit p if p can be obtained as a subset sum.; At i th iteration, bit[i] stores the initial sum and … somerset waste partnership fromeWebMar 28, 2024 · Let’s implement bitset in C++, such that following operations can be performed in stated time complexities :. init(int size): initializes a bitset of size number of 0 bits.; void fix(int pos): Change the bit at position pos to 1.No change if it was already 1. void unfix(int pos): Change the bit at position pos to 0.No change if it was already 0. small cat power boatsWebJan 30, 2024 · 1. __builtin_popcount (x) This function is used to count the number of one’s (set bits) in an integer. if x = 4 binary value of 4 is 100 Output: No of ones is 1. Note: Similarly you can use __builtin_popcountl (x) & __builtin_popcountll (x) for long and long long data types. small cats for sale ukWebMay 4,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. small cat rugWebJun 17, 2024 · Time Complexity: O(N), N is length of bitset Auxiliary Space: O(N) Subtraction of 2 bitsets: Follow the steps below to solve the problem: Initialize a bool borrow to false.; Create a bitset ans to store the difference between the two bitsets x and y.; Traverse the length of the bitsets x and y and use the fullSubtractor function to determine … somerset weather eyeWebJan 26, 2011 · The Algorithm that we follow is to count all the bits that are set to 1. Now if we want to count through that bitset for a number n, we would go through log(n)+1 digits. … small cat roomWebFeb 17, 2024 · Count pairs in an array which have at least one digit common; ... Time Complexity: O(1) Auxiliary Space: O(1) Method 2: Recursive ... We can use the bitset class of C++ to store the binary representation of any number (positive as well as a negative number). It offers us the flexibility to have the number of bits of our desire, like whether … small cat radiator bed